Today's ; image is a negative minibrot, which is not quite true to life, ; since the negative effect was totally created by the coloring. ; The minibrot itself is nothing more than an everyday run-of-the- ; mill minibrot given interest by rendering the entire scene with ; the outside set to 'tdis'. ; ; The negative effect gives a rather ominous feeling to the image. ; I have occasionally seen this effect used in Japanese 'anime' ; cartoons. The name "Negative Minibrot" is self explanatory. ; The calculation time of 39 seconds is no error. This ; small hassle may be avoided by checking the finished image on ; the FOTD web site at: ; ; ; ; and forgetting about running the parameter file. ; ; The parent fractal came about when I combined 0.1 part of Z^10 ; with one part of Z^1.5 and added straight C. This parent is a ; mis-shapen Mandelbrot set rotated about 180 degrees, with a ; large open area extending beyond its east (west) valley and a ; curled-up main stem. Today's scene lies on a kind of figure-8 ; shaped hole on this curled stem. ; ; The weather here at Fractal Central on Monday was almost ; perfect.
